What Are Gun Shows?

Gun shows are essentially trade shows focused on firearms, ammunition, related accessories, and related services. These events bring together vendors, collectors, and enthusiasts in a single location, offering a diverse array of products and opportunities for interaction.

Vendors at gun shows in Knoxville typically include a variety of businesses and individuals. You’ll find licensed firearm dealers, offering new and used guns for sale. There are often private sellers, legally able to sell their personal firearms. Vendors specializing in ammunition are also common. Additionally, accessory vendors are often present, selling gun parts, scopes, holsters, cleaning supplies, knives, and other related equipment. There may also be representatives from gun clubs, training organizations, and other industry-related entities.

The items for sale at a gun show in Knoxville are wide-ranging. Of course, firearms themselves are a major draw. These can include handguns, rifles, shotguns, and antique firearms. Ammunition in various calibers is readily available. Accessories such as scopes, red dot sights, tactical lights, and laser sights are popular. You can also find magazines, gun cases, cleaning kits, and a variety of related parts. For collectors, there are often antique firearms, historical artifacts, and other items of interest. Knives, from folding pocket knives to hunting knives, are frequently sold at these events as well.

Understanding the legal framework is a core part of attending a gun show in Knoxville. Federal laws, particularly those relating to firearms transfers, apply. Background checks are required for sales by licensed dealers. State laws regulate the sale, possession, and transportation of firearms. Ensure you are familiar with these laws. Tennessee state law also plays a role, and you must comply with all applicable state regulations. Local ordinances might also apply in specific areas. Familiarize yourself with any local regulations that may pertain to the city or county where the gun show is taking place.

Private sales at gun shows in Knoxville do take place, but they are also subject to regulations. In Tennessee, private sellers are not required to conduct background checks. However, it is always recommended that both parties involved in a private sale are aware of their respective responsibilities. It’s a good idea to have a bill of sale to detail the transaction. Be aware of legal responsibilities and make sure all parties are following them.

Safety Considerations and Responsible Gun Ownership

Safety is paramount when it comes to firearms. Understanding the basics is crucial for anyone who owns, handles, or is around firearms.

Gun safety is not just a recommendation, it is a fundamental responsibility. It requires consistent awareness and a commitment to following established safety rules. A firearm is a powerful tool, and it is critical to treat every firearm with respect and always prioritize safety.

Safe handling practices are the cornerstone of responsible gun ownership. The most fundamental rule is to treat every gun as if it is loaded. Keep your finger off the trigger until you are ready to fire. Never point a firearm at anything you are not willing to destroy. Be aware of your target and what is beyond it. Handle firearms carefully, and avoid distractions when handling them.

Proper storage is crucial for preventing unauthorized access to firearms and accidents. Gun safes provide a secure way to store firearms, protecting them from theft and accidental use. Trigger locks or cable locks also offer a measure of security, making it difficult for unauthorized individuals to operate a firearm. The goal is to make your firearms inaccessible to anyone who should not have them, including children.

Training and education are highly recommended. Consider taking a firearm safety course to learn the fundamentals of safe gun handling and operation. Many local gun clubs and organizations offer courses. Regularly practice your shooting skills, and always prioritize safety when you are on the range.

Your legal responsibilities as a gun owner are also important. Be aware of federal, state, and local laws regarding firearm ownership, use, and transportation. Compliance with all applicable laws is essential.
